| dc.description.abstract | Purpose: In the present study, the visual discomfort induced by smart mobile devices was assessed in normaland healthy adults. Methods: Fifty-nine volunteers (age, 38.16 ± 10.23 years; male : female = 19 : 40) were exposed to tabletcomputer screen stimuli (iPad Air, Apple Inc.) for 1 hour. Participants watched a movie or played a computergame on the tablet computer. Visual fatigue and discomfort were assessed using an asthenopia questionnaire,tear film break-up time, and total ocular wavefront aberration before and after viewing smart mobiledevices. Results: Based on the questionnaire, viewing smart mobile devices for 1 hour significantly increased meantotal asthenopia score from 19.59 ± 8.58 to 22.68 ± 9.39 (p < 0.001). Specifically, the scores for five items(tired eyes, sore/aching eyes, irritated eyes, watery eyes, and hot/burning eye) were significantly increasedby viewing smart mobile devices. Tear film break-up time significantly decreased from 5.09 ± 1.52 secondsto 4.63 ± 1.34 seconds (p = 0.003). However, total ocular wavefront aberration was unchanged. Conclusions: Visual fatigue and discomfort were significantly induced by viewing smart mobile devices, eventhough the devices were equipped with state-of-the-art display technology. | - |
